MU Extension's Osher Lifelong Learning Institute (Osher@Mizzou) is a lifelong learning program that provides a variety of noncredit, affordable courses and other educational, cultural, and social offerings designed for adults aged 50 plus, all for the joy of learning. Osher@Mizzou currently offers more than 100 classes each year over four semesters during its academic year. For more information about Osher@Mizzou, visit osher.missouri.edu. UNIVERSITY INFORMATION The University of Missouri, also known as Mizzou and MU, is the Flagship University of the four-campus University of Missouri system. It is the state's land-grant university and one of the most comprehensive universities in the United States. MU's broad undergraduate programs and its' graduate, professional and research programs attract annual enrollment of more than 30,000 students. MU is centrally located in Columbia, MO, which is consistently ranked as one of America's most livable cities. MU Extension and Engagement programs are located on all four campuses and in 114 counties and St. Louis city. Shift
